Over-The-Counter Wart Removal Products
Over-the-counter wart removers, like any other over-the-counter products, are obtainable for sale at the bulk retail stores. These retail stores include grocery stores, department stores, health and beauty stores, as well as drug stores. The difference between prescription medications and over-the-counter items or medications is that a prescription is not needed. Essentially, this means that you can walk right into your local drug store and purchase a wart elimination product, without ever having to visit your doctor. In addition to being easy to get, over-the-counter wart removers are in favor because they are relatively easy to afford. The cost of an over-the-counter wart remover will all depend on which type of product you purchase. If this is your first time purchasing an over-the-counter wart remover, you will soon find out that you have a number of dissimilar options. Aside from having numerous product manufacturers to select from, you will also have a number of dissimilar wart remover types to select from. These types typically include medicated bandages or freeze-off formulas. Perhaps, the the bulk popular type of wart remover currently obtainable for sale, over-the-counter, is the freeze-off wart removers. As mentioned above, freeze-off wart removers are made by a number of dissimilar product manufacturers. Since the concepts of these items are just about the same, you will find that, in the bulk cases, the only difference is the price. Regardless of which type of freeze-off wart remover you choose, you should easily be able to afford the purchase. This is because the bulk freeze-off wart removers sell for around twenty dollars. As previously mentioned, in addition to freeze-off wart removers, you could also find wart removal items that use medicated bandages. These wart removal items are significantly cheaper than the freeze-off wart elimination formulas. The cost of medicated wart elimination bandages or pads will all depend on how almighty of a package you wish to purchase. At the bulk retail stores, a standard size box only costs between three and five dollars. As affordable as these wart elimination pads or bandages are, you will find that they take time to effectively work. Unlike a lot freeze-off wart removers, the medicated pads or bandages do not work right away. In fact, some of these items have been known to take around two weeks or even a month to work.
